Diplomacy has gone strongly digital, Foreign Secretary Harsh Vardhan Shringla says

Foreign Secretary Harsh Vardhan Shringla has said that India has been proactive in assessing and dealing with the challenges caused by COVID-19 as Prime Minister Narendra Modi is turning challenge into an opportunity to start global conversations using a virtual platform.

During the webinar, he was addressing  the Institute of Chartered Accountants of India on implementing the vision of  Atma Nirbhar Bharat. Mr. Shringla said that saving lives has been our foremost priority. He said while the case load in the country continues to be high; India has fared comparatively better than many other countries with a low death rate and high recovery rate. We also have improvised capacities in our healthcare sector for the past few months.

He said, to deal with economic challenges posed due to the pandemic and to bring the economy of the country back on track, the Prime Minister has adopted a forward-looking economic approach under the rubric of Atmnirbhar Bharat Abhiyaan.

The enormous package of 20 lakh crore rupees launched under the Abhiyaan aims to both invigorate the economy and provide a social safety net to our vulnerable sections. Mr. Shringla said industry associations such as the ICAI are a critical part of our economic diplomacy and outreach.
